Discs heal just like your muscles and bones do. There’s a lot of fear in the world today about spine and disc injuries, but the truth is that the body is often highly capable of healing these things!
To be fair, a herniated disc sounds terrifying – the covering of the disc tears/ruptures and the gel-like disc material bulges out, sometimes pinching down on a nerve in your spine. This creates pain at the spot where the tear happened, and can cause radiating pain, numbness, and even weakness into your arms or legs, depending on what level in your spine the herniated disc happened.
Surgery isn’t super common with disc herniations, as the pain often goes away on its own after a couple days to weeks. It’s very important to try and stay active while your body is healing, taking advantage of movements that don’t cause a lot of pain so that your body keeps the blood moving around, effectively healing the herniation.

How do disc herniations happen?
Disc herniations are extremely common that can happen from lifting heavy objects, having a car accident, falling down from something high, or even from simple things like sneezing or bending over! How do I know I have a disc herniation?
Symptoms of disc herniation include pain localized to the spine, pain with numbness or tingling radiating down the leg or into the arms, and stiffness with movement. The most common disc herniations happen in your lumbar, or lower, spine and radiate down your legs.
